摘要
Recently, the keyboard interfaces variously have been provided such as the hardware interface and the software interface. With smart mobile devices is supported with some software interfaces, but the number of interfaces are limited. This paper proposes an idea to provide dynamic interface for keyboard interface of smart mobile devices. The users can create their own interfaces or use the interfaces which are provided by server. We also propose SLAN communication, that help the interfaces can be easily shared between mobile devices. The user's IP or unique device name without knowing 1:1 or 1: N communication can be shared. Using SLAN to transmit the interface between smart mobile devices more quickly, efficiently than telecommunication that was used previously, and this is demonstrated through experiments.
